New Findings on the Implementation of Teacher and Principal Performance Measures

A new report looks at the implementation of a set of three performance measures for teachers and principals. The report provides descriptive information on what teachers and principals experienced during the first year of implementation and how well the measures differentiated performance. » More info

REL Northwest Study Links Advanced Coursetaking Disparities for Current and Former English Learners to Academic Preparation and Schools They Attend

The study found that where students attend school and their academic preparation account for much of the difference in advanced coursetaking among English learner students and their never-English learner peers. » More info

New Practice Guide: Teaching Secondary Students to Write Effectively

Effective writing is a vital component of students' literacy achievement and a life-long skill that plays a key role in postsecondary success. A new What Works Clearinghouse (WWC) practice guide provides evidence-based recommendations to help students in grades 6-12 develop effective writing skills. Teaching Secondary Students to Write Effectively provides tips and strategies to help students plan and think critically in their writing, and includes examples to use in the classroom, including sample writing strategies and prompts, and activities that incorporate writing and reading. » More info

Standards and Review

The Standards and Review Office (SRO) is responsible for two primary activities: the review of IES reports and the peer review process for the grant applications.

Guide to Education Data Privacy

This free resource for states and districts was developed by practitioners in the field through the National Forum on Education Statistics. It is designed to assist school staff in protecting the confidentiality of student data.
